The Peoples Democratic Party, PDP, in the Northeast, have declared
their support for the presidential ambition of former Vice President,
Atiku Abubakar and Gombe state Governor, Hassan Dankwambo.
They made their position known at a meeting on Thursday in Gombe to
discuss how to clinch the party's presidential ticket for the 2019
general election.
In a communiqué released at the end of the meeting chaired by Zonal
Chairman, Amb. Emmanuel Njiwah, the zone agreed to solicit for support
from other geo-political zones.
Chairman of the PDP in Adamawa State, Barr. Tahir Shehu, disclosed
that zonal elders have been meeting with party leaders in other
regions, especially the North West.
"The PDP North East zonal office has resolved to work for the
emergence of either Gov. Dankwambo or Atiku Abubakar as the party's
flag-bearer come 2019," he said.
The stakeholders noted that the region had been left out despite
contributing to the emergence of presidents from other zones,
particularly the North West.
"This time around, we feel the North East should be given the chance
to produce the next flag-bearer of the PDP," Shehu added.
He said the gathering, however, condemned the killing of innocent
Nigerians in the North "without proactive measures by the APC-led
Federal Government to tackle the carnage."
